CSS锚点定位实战-鼠标跟随交互效果

💡 原文中文,约3700字,阅读约需9分钟。
📝

内容提要

本文介绍了CSS锚点定位API的应用,简化了浮层元素的定位,减少了JavaScript的使用。通过案例展示了选中态标识动效和菜单悬停跟随效果,强调了锚点定位的实用性和兼容性,鼓励开发者在项目中应用这一特性。

🎯

关键要点

  • 锚点定位API简化了浮层元素的定位,减少了JavaScript的使用。
  • 所有现代浏览器均已支持锚点定位API。
  • 案例1展示了选中态标识动效,通过伪元素创建绿色勾勾,使用锚点定位实现动画效果。
  • 案例2展示了菜单悬停跟随效果,使用CSS伪元素创建背景内阴影,无需额外HTML。
  • 锚点定位可以作为增强特性使用,不影响现有实现,鼓励开发者在项目中应用。

延伸问答

CSS锚点定位API的主要功能是什么?

CSS锚点定位API简化了浮层元素的定位,减少了JavaScript的使用。

锚点定位API在现代浏览器中的兼容性如何?

所有现代浏览器均已支持锚点定位API。

如何使用CSS实现选中态标识动效?

通过伪元素创建绿色勾勾,使用锚点定位实现动画效果,当单选项被选中时显示该勾勾。

菜单悬停跟随效果是如何实现的?

使用CSS伪元素创建背景内阴影,结合锚点定位实现菜单项的悬停跟随效果,无需额外HTML。

锚点定位API可以作为什么样的特性使用?

锚点定位可以作为增强特性使用,不影响现有实现,鼓励开发者在项目中应用。

如果浏览器不支持锚点定位API,应该怎么办?

如果浏览器不支持,可以直接创建内阴影效果,不影响功能。

➡️

继续阅读